// client.cpp,v 1.2 2002/03/13 11:47:48 jwillemsen Exp
#include "testC.h"
#include "tao/debug.h"
#include "ace/Get_Opt.h"
#include "ace/Task.h"
ACE_RCSID(MT_Client, client, "client.cpp,v 1.16 2002/01/29 20:21:08 okellogg Exp")
const char *ior = "file://test.ior";
const char *corbaloc_arg = "corbaloc:iiop:1.0@localhost:12000/ObjectName";
int nthreads = 5;
int niterations = 5;
int server_shutdown = 0;
int
parse_args (int argc, char *argv[])
{
ACE_Get_Opt get_opts (argc, argv, "l:k:n:i:x");
int c;
while ((c = get_opts ()) != -1)
switch (c)
{
case 'k':
ior = get_opts.opt_arg ();
break;
case 'l':
corbaloc_arg = get_opts.opt_arg ();
break;
case 'n':
nthreads = ACE_OS::atoi (get_opts.opt_arg ());
break;
case 'i':
niterations = ACE_OS::atoi (get_opts.opt_arg ());
break;
case 'x':
server_shutdown = 1;
break;
case '?':
default:
ACE_ERROR_RETURN ((LM_ERROR,
"usage: %s "
"-k <ior> "
"-n <nthreads> "
"-i <niterations> "
"\n",
argv [0]),
-1);
}
// Indicates sucessful parsing of the command line
return 0;
}
class Client : public ACE_Task_Base
{
// = TITLE
// Run the client thread
//
// = DESCRIPTION
// Use the ACE_Task_Base class to run the client threads.
//
public:
Client (Simple_Server_ptr server, int niterations);
// ctor
virtual int svc (void);
// The thread entry point.
private:
void validate_connection (ACE_ENV_SINGLE_ARG_DECL_NOT_USED);
// Validate the connection
private:
Simple_Server_var server_;
// The server.
int niterations_;
// The number of iterations on each client thread.
};
int
main (int argc, char *argv[])
{
ACE_TRY_NEW_ENV
{
CORBA::ORB_var orb =
CORBA::ORB_init (argc, argv, "" ACE_ENV_ARG_PARAMETER);
ACE_TRY_CHECK;
if (parse_args (argc, argv) != 0)
return 1;
CORBA::Object_var object =
orb->string_to_object (ior ACE_ENV_ARG_PARAMETER);
ACE_TRY_CHECK;
Simple_Server_var server =
Simple_Server::_narrow (object.in () ACE_ENV_ARG_PARAMETER);
ACE_TRY_CHECK;
if (CORBA::is_nil (server.in ()))
{
ACE_ERROR_RETURN ((LM_ERROR,
"Object reference <%s> is nil\n",
ior),
1);
}
Client client (server.in (), niterations);
if (client.activate (THR_NEW_LWP | THR_JOINABLE,
nthreads) != 0)
ACE_ERROR_RETURN ((LM_ERROR,
"Cannot activate client threads\n"),
1);
// While those threads are busy sending 1.2 messages
// send some corba loc requests, don't really care if there is an
// object there to find
if (!server_shutdown)
{
ACE_DEBUG ((LM_DEBUG,
"starting string_to_object %s \n",
corbaloc_arg));
for (int c = 0; c < (niterations * 2); c++)
{
ACE_TRY_EX (CORBALOC)
{
CORBA::Object_var probably_not_exist =
orb->string_to_object(corbaloc_arg
ACE_ENV_ARG_PARAMETER);
ACE_TRY_CHECK_EX (CORBALOC);
if (CORBA::is_nil(probably_not_exist.in()))
{
ACE_DEBUG ((LM_DEBUG, "not found\n", corbaloc_arg));
}
else
{
Simple_Server_var newserver =
Simple_Server::_narrow (probably_not_exist.in ()
ACE_ENV_ARG_PARAMETER);
ACE_TRY_CHECK_EX (CORBALOC);
// should throw an exception
if (CORBA::is_nil(newserver.in()))
{
ACE_DEBUG ((LM_DEBUG, "not found it\n", corbaloc_arg));
}
else
{
ACE_DEBUG ((LM_DEBUG, "found it\n", corbaloc_arg));
}
}
}
ACE_CATCHANY
{
// ACE_DEBUG ((LM_DEBUG, "caught exception\n", corbaloc_arg));
}
ACE_ENDTRY;
}
}
ACE_DEBUG ((LM_DEBUG,
"(%P|%t) waiting for threads\n"));
client.thr_mgr ()->wait ();
ACE_DEBUG ((LM_DEBUG,
"(%P|%t) threads finished\n"));
if (server_shutdown)
{
server->shutdown (ACE_ENV_SINGLE_ARG_PARAMETER);
ACE_TRY_CHECK;
}
orb->destroy (ACE_ENV_SINGLE_ARG_PARAMETER);
ACE_TRY_CHECK;
}
ACE_CATCHANY
{
ACE_PRINT_EXCEPTION (ACE_ANY_EXCEPTION,
"Caught exception:");
return 1;
}
ACE_ENDTRY;
return 0;
}
// ****************************************************************
Client::Client (Simple_Server_ptr server,
int niterations)
: server_ (Simple_Server::_duplicate (server)),
niterations_ (niterations)
{
}
void
Client::validate_connection (ACE_ENV_SINGLE_ARG_DECL)
{
// Ping the object 100 times, ignoring all exceptions.
// It would be better to use validate_connection() but the test must
// run on minimum CORBA builds too!
for (int j = 0; j != 100; ++j)
{
ACE_TRY
{
this->server_->test_method (j ACE_ENV_ARG_PARAMETER);
ACE_TRY_CHECK;
}
ACE_CATCHANY {} ACE_ENDTRY;
}
}
int
Client::svc (void)
{
ACE_TRY_NEW_ENV
{
this->validate_connection (ACE_ENV_SINGLE_ARG_PARAMETER);
ACE_TRY_CHECK;
for (int i = 0; i < this->niterations_; ++i)
{
this->server_->test_method (i ACE_ENV_ARG_PARAMETER);
ACE_TRY_CHECK;
if (TAO_debug_level > 0 && i % 100 == 0)
ACE_DEBUG ((LM_DEBUG, "(%P|%t) iteration = %d\n",
i));
}
}
ACE_CATCHANY
{
ACE_PRINT_EXCEPTION (ACE_ANY_EXCEPTION,
"MT_Client: exception raised");
}
ACE_ENDTRY;
return 0;
}
